Gather your ingredients

Before you start cooking, make sure you have everything you need at hand. Here’s your shopping list for Crock Pot Tuscan Chicken:

  • 2 lbs boneless, skinless chicken thighs or breasts
  • 1 cup chicken broth (for that extra depth of flavor)
  • 1 cup heavy cream or a lighter alternative
  • 1 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ped (the star of the dish!)
  • 1 teaspoon minced garlic (add more for garlic lovers)
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ning blend
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 1 cup chopped spinach (fresh is best)
  • Optional: sprinkle of parmesan cheese for serving
  • Optional: crispy turkey bacon or cooked chicken ham for added taste

Don’t forget to gather your cooking tools as well. You’ll need a Crock Pot, measuring cups, and cutting boards. Preparing everything ahead saves time and keeps your process smooth.

Prepare the sauce

Now that you have your ingredients, let’s get to that delicious sauce.

  1. In a medium bowl, mix the chicken broth, heavy cream, sun-dried tomatoes, minced garlic, and Italian seasoning.
  2. Use a whisk to blend it all together until you achieve a smooth and creamy texture.
  3. Taste your mixture and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per as needed. A well-seasoned sauce is key to delicious chicken!

If you’re looking for flavor variations, consider how adding a splash of lemon juice or a dash of red pepper flakes can elevate the taste.

Arrange the chicken in the Crock Pot

Now it’s time to place the star of the dish—the chicken.

  1. Open your Crock Pot and lay the chicken thighs or breasts at the bottom.
  2. Make sure they’re spaced out evenly; this helps them cook properly.
  3. If you’re using turkey bacon or chicken ham, feel free to layer it here for extra flavor!

This step is crucial. If the chicken is overcrowded, it won’t cook evenly, and you’ll miss out on that tender goodness!

Pour the sauce over the chicken

With your chicken arranged, it’s time to do the satisfying part: pouring the sauce!

  1. Gently pour the prepared sauce over the chicken, ensuring it’s well-covered. Remember, coverage means flavor!
  2. If you prefer, you can reserve a little bit of the sauce to drizzle on when serving.

The sun-dried tomatoes and any optional meats will add layers of flavor, making each bite enjoyable.

Set the Crock Pot and wait

Now to the waiting game—don’t worry, it’s worth it!

  1. Close the lid of the Crock Pot and set it to low for about 6 to 8 hours or high for 3 to 4 hours.
  2. Just let it do its magic. This is the perfect time to catch up on your favorite show or read a book—productivity at its finest!

While cooking, the chicken will absorb all the wonderful flavors, making the final dish incredibly rich and satisfying.

Add spinach and finish cooking

When the cooking time is nearly up, it’s time to add some fresh greens.

  1. About 30 minutes before serving, open the lid and stir in the chopped spinach.
  2. Replace the lid and allow it to wilt into the sauce. This not only adds color but nutritional value as well!

Spinach makes a lovely complement to the rich sauce and chicken, providing a nice contrast in both taste and texture.

How do I store leftovers?

Storing leftovers from your Crock Pot Tuscan Chicken is simple. Divide the chicken and sauce into airtight containers and refrigerate them for up to 3-4 days. For longer storage, consider freezing the portions. Just ensure you let the dish cool completely before freezing—this helps maintain its flavor and texture. When you’re ready to enjoy it again, thaw it overnight in the fridge and reheat in the microwave or on the stove. Perfect for a quick lunch or dinner!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 chicken breasts
  • 1 cup turkey bacon, chopped
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 can diced tomatoes
  • 1 cup spinach,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 cup parmesan cheese, grated
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. In a Crock Pot, combine the chicken breasts, turkey bacon, onion, and garlic.
  2. Add the diced tomatoes and spinach, and sprinkle with Italian seasoning.
  3.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or until the chicken is cooked through.
  5. Before serving, sprinkle with parmesan cheese.

Notes

  • Serve with pasta or rice for a complete meal.
  • For extra flavor, marinate chicken in spices overnight.
